The Wheel at the Center: Living with Arcanum 10 as Your Life Purpose

What This Placement Actually Means

When the Wheel of Fortune sits at the center of your Matrix — position E, the Life Purpose — you aren't just someone who experiences change. You are someone whose entire mission is organized around it. The Wheel here isn't background noise; it's the engine.

This doesn't mean your life will be chaotic or unstable. It means you came in to understand cycles — how they turn, why they turn, and what's available at each point of the rotation. Where others treat upheaval as an interruption, you're here to learn that the turning is the point. Your purpose is to become fluent in change itself, and then to help others navigate it.

In practice, people with Arcanum 10 at center often find themselves at inflection points — repeatedly. Career pivots, relocations, relationship shifts, industry disruptions. The specifics vary, but the pattern holds: your life keeps moving, and your growth comes from staying present inside that movement rather than fighting to freeze it.

Strengths This Combination Confers

The Wheel at center gives you a genuine advantage that most people spend years trying to cultivate: adaptability without panic. When you're aligned with this energy, you read shifting circumstances faster than those around you. You sense when a cycle is ending before the evidence is obvious. That's not luck — it's a trained perceptual skill that this placement is asking you to develop.

You also carry a natural capacity for big-picture thinking. The Wheel sees from above the mechanism, not just from inside one spoke. This makes you well-suited for strategy, for spotting patterns across time, and for offering perspective to people who are too close to their own situation to see it clearly.

There's also an ease with reinvention. Where others mourn the old version of themselves, you have a latent talent for stepping into the next one without requiring the transition to be tidy.

Challenges This Placement Brings

The hardest thing about carrying Arcanum 10 at center is the temptation to wait for the wheel to turn rather than act. Because change has always come, there can be a passive streak — a belief that if you just hold on long enough, conditions will improve on their own. Sometimes they do. But this placement is not a permission slip for avoidance dressed up as patience.

There's also a risk of chronic restlessness. If you've internalized that change is good, you may manufacture it unnecessarily — leaving stable situations, disrupting things that don't need disrupting — because stillness feels like stagnation. The Wheel turns, yes, but it also has a hub: a fixed center around which everything else rotates. Finding your hub — your values, your commitments, your non-negotiables — is the counterweight this placement demands.

Finally, the Wheel can produce inconsistency in how others experience you. If your purpose involves shifting through phases, the people in your life may struggle to track which version of you they're dealing with. Intentional communication becomes essential.

How to Work With This Energy

Start by mapping your cycles rather than being surprised by them. Keep a simple record of when things shift — opportunities, moods, relationships, creative dry spells and floods. Over time, you'll recognize your personal rhythms. The Wheel isn't random; it's patterned. Learning your pattern is one of the most practical things you can do with this placement.

Seek roles and structures that expect evolution from you. The Wheel in center chafes under rigid, unchanging environments. You don't need chaos — you need room to grow built into the design of your life.

And when you're in a low point of the cycle — because there will be low points — resist the urge to treat it as failure. A Wheel at the bottom is still a Wheel. It's already turning.
